Finance Review — Brightfern Franchise Agreement

Quick summary for you as you step in: the franchise deal with Brightfern Eateries is performing ahead of plan. Royalty receipts from the Laketon and Merrow sites came in strong, and the renewal clause triggers next spring. Legal flagged nothing serious, just some boilerplate to tidy up. The forward plan is summarised in the note below.

board note of kageg-bahof: The renewal with Holwynax Holdings closes at $2 million a year, 5 percent below the last contract. Project Ulaath slips by two quarters because of the supplier delay.

**Ticket: Log sampling drift on Pemberly notifier**

Hey — the notifier is chatty again and someone bumped the sampling rate by hand on two of the four nodes, so our volume graphs are lying to us. Please reconcile everything back to what's in the repo. The intended sampling config is below.

config for tagep-yajef:
ulawyn:
  log_level: error
  metrics_host: metrics.ulawyn.lumiclabs.internal
  pin: 0564
  pool_size: 32

- [ ] **Proctoring queue drain check (Vantora Exams):** Before promoting the release, confirm the proctoring review queue has drained below fifty pending sessions and that no worker is mid-migration. A deploy during active drain can orphan session locks. Record completion against the build token shown below.

session token of fahop-tawig = htk3_da3

Welcome to on-call for Nightloom, our nightly backfill scheduler. Short version: it kicks off data backfills at 02:00, retries twice, then pages you. Most fixes are just re-queuing the failed window from the admin panel. If the panel itself is down, you'll need the emergency console, which unlocks with the recovery passphrase below.

strongbox words: sorir-belvan-rusix-ulays-ralmir-praix-eliir-tamax-praael-druael-julir-tamius-jorir